Bob owned and operated his tugboat the "Strady XV" for many years out of Campbell River. He lived on-board the "Strady XV" and worked her throughout the north coast. For the last several years he put his passion for diving to work and was an urchin fisherman working from his latest boat the "Manatee". "Tugboat Bob" will be missed. He was loved for his crazy sense of humor, eccentric character and never ending supply of tales collected from his lifetime of navigating and working his way up and down the British Columbia coastline. Bob's presence was captivating, and few who met him would soon forget his colourful disposition. We will all miss you Bob.
